Taiwan Tech Trek

  1. Taiwan Tech Trek website: https://ap0512.most.gov.tw/ttt/intern_list.aspx
    (Hosted by the Ministry of Science and Technology)
  2. Program Summary:
    (1) Internship Quota: 230~280 interns, including 3~10 domestic interns
    (2) Internship Duration:
    1. Full Course: 2015/6/21~2015/8/15
    2. Group Activity: 2015/6/21~2015/6/26
    3. Intern Activity: 2015/6/29~2015/8/15
    4. If the intern wishes to begin ahead, or extend the internship schedule, it is the intern’s responsibility to contact the hosting department, and discuss the details of the desired time and internship content, and to receive approval from the said department. Neither living subsidiaries nor accommodations will be given for the time not within the original schedule. Interns must participate in the full duration of the internship even if they start ahead of the schedule.

    (3) Subsidiaries

    1. Intern Living Subsidiaries: Ministry of Science and Technology will provide each intern 600NT/day. full course participant will receive a total of 30000NT. (50days)
    2. International Intern Airfare Subsidiaries: Ministry of Science and Technology will provide each intern with 10000NT for traveling subsidiaries.
    3. Food and accommodations will be provided during the group activity period. (6/21~6/26)

    (4) Internship Qualification
    I. Domestic Student:

    1. Must be aged between 18~30 years old. (Born between 1985/8/15 ~1997/6/21)
    2. Must have previously participated in Ministry of Science and Technology’s Under-graduate student research seminar in years 2010~2014.
    3. Must be fluent in English, especially writing and speaking. Interns must provide English fluency certification. (One of following, General English Proficiency Test (GEPT) at least high-intermediate level, International English Language Testing System (IELTS) score at least 5.5, Internet-Based Test (IBT TOEFL) at least 61, Test of English for International Communication (TOEIC) at least 600)
    4. The previous Taiwan Tech Trek participant may apply again, but first-timer will have priority.

    II. International Student:

    1. Must be aged between 18~30 years old. (Born between 1985/8/15 ~1997/6/21)
    2. Must be ethnic Taiwanese.
    3. Must not receive education beyond elementary level in Taiwan. (Including American schools and other foreign schools in Taiwan)
    4. Education level must be at least college sophomore and up. (Or will complete sophomore before 2015/6/21)
    5. Must not have full-time working experience in Taiwan. (Excluding Internship)
    6. Must be able to communicate with English, Mandarin, or Taiwanese. (Must fill out the language fluency questionnaires on the application form, and language fluency certification documents can be attached with the application form.)
    7. Non-studentship is not restricted, but if the applicant has Republic of China citizenship, compulsory military service might affect the applicant.
    8. The previous Taiwan Tech Trek participant may apply again, but first-timer will have priority.
